Notes The purpose of this study; The aim is to examine the non-formal religious education activities carried out during the ninth President of Religious Affairs, Ali Rıza Hakses, about whom there is no study based on primary sources in the literature. In the study built on the descriptive scanning model, the documentary scanning technique was preferred in the data collection process and the descriptive analysis method was preferred in the analysis of the data. As a result, it has been determined that Hakses is an important religious scholar who witnessed the collapse of the Ottoman Empire and the establishment of the Republic, and who had knowledge of the institutional structure of the organization, its current problems and their solutions through the different duties he undertook. However, as a result of this accumulation, it was determined that the main objectives that the organization tried to achieve regarding non-formal religious education activities during the Hakses period were as follows: To issue the statutes and regulations necessary for the Presidency of Religious Affairs; to raise the professional formation of organization members; to increase the number and efficiency of places of worship in the country; To use religious and national days effectively for the unity and solidarity of the nation; To create a library in all mufti offices that provide religious services in the provincial organization and to increase the number and variety of religious publications and press services.
